A citation can be found under the Peter Medawar entry on Wikiquote;

Yet the greater part of it, I shall show, is nonsense, tricked out with a variety of metaphysical conceits, and its author can be excused of dishonesty only on the grounds that before deceiving others he has taken great pains to deceive himself.

* Review of Teilhard de Chardin’s The Phenomenon of Man, Mind, 70, pp 99 to 105.
